HONDA Stateline VT1300CR 1312 (2009 - 2010) Description & History: Clean lines and a flowing, fluid design are the most likely the first things which will make heads turn when the 2009 Honda Stateline VT1300CR comes around the corner. Rich in classic cues, such as the deeply valanced fenders and the laid back riding position, the 2009 Stateline is literally dripping with modern technology for a great riding experience.
A brawny and fuel efficient engine delivers plenty of power and torque for all scenarios, whether you're just cruising through the city or riding fast on the highway. The raked out fork provides exceptional stability, while the shaft final drive offers effortless power conveying to the ground with no hassle and minimal maintenance.
